The American Society for Nondestructive Testing (ASNT) SNT TC 1A is a globally recognized standard that provides guidelines for the certification and qualification of nondestructive testing personnel. It ensures that NDT professionals possess the necessary skills and knowledge to perform inspections accurately and reliably across various industries, including aerospace, construction, oil and gas, and manufacturing. This comprehensive review aims to explore the key aspects of the 2024 revision, its implications for practitioners, and the evolving landscape of nondestructive testing certification. --- Understanding ASNT SNT TC 1A: An Overview ASNT SNT TC 1A (Standard for Qualification and Certification of Nondestructive Testing Personnel) has long served as the foundational document for certifying NDT technicians and inspectors in the United States and internationally. Developed by the American Society for Nondestructive Testing (ASNT), the standard provides detailed guidelines on training, qualification, and certification processes, ensuring a consistent approach toward safety, competency, and quality assurance. Key Role of SNT TC 1A - Establishes the minimum requirements for personnel qualification. - Defines the knowledge, skills, and experience needed. - Guides certification bodies in evaluating and certifying NDT personnel. - Promotes standardization across industries and regions.
